  • Sovereign Hill: Step back in time at Sovereign Hill, a living museum that recreates the gold rush era. Explore historic buildings, watch gold pouring demonstrations, and pan for gold in the river. The cultural vibe here is palpable, making it a unique experience to learn about Australia's rich history.
  • Kryal Castle: Experience a taste of medieval life at Kryal Castle, where you can attend jousting events and explore the impressive castle grounds. With its event and conference facilities, it offers a blend of business and entertainment in a captivating setting, making it an intriguing stop.
  • Lake Wendouree: Relax at Lake Wendouree, a picturesque spot perfect for picnics and romantic strolls. Enjoy the beach-like atmosphere, scenic views, and outdoor activities such as rowing and cycling, making it a delightful place to unwind and connect with nature.

Best time to go to Wallace

The best time to visit Wallace is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January66.4°F (19.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February64.8°F (18.2°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March61.0°F (16.1°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
April55.0°F (12.8°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
May49.1°F (9.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
June45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July44.1°F (6.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
August45.0°F (7.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
September48.4°F (9.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
October52.7°F (11.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
December61.7°F (16.5°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Wallace

If you're planning to visit Wallace, Victoria, you have a few airport options. Melbourne Airport (MEL-Tullamarine) is situated 70.8km away, with nearby hotels like the 5-star Stamford Plaza Melbourne, The Langham, and Hyatt Centric, all approximately 19.3km from the airport, offering transfer services. Alternatively, Melbourne Airport (AVV-Avalon) is 64.4km from Wallace, with excellent accommodation options such as the 4.5-star Quality Hotel Bayside Geelong and 4-star Rydges Geelong, both within 17.7km. Lastly, Bendigo Airport (BXG) is 93.3km away, with options like Quest Bendigo Central just 3.2km from the airport, ensuring convenient access for your stay.

What's the weather like in Wallace?

The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Wallace is 707 mm.
